Company Information:
Operating since 2013, Pioneer Academics is an American education organization that values integrity, mutual respect and teamwork. It offers every team member the chance to engage in a dynamic and exciting entrepreneurial environment on a global playing field.
Pioneer Academics created the new concept and model where college-level research opportunities are granted online to exceptional, motivated high school students from around the world to produce student-led research papers. Selected students work one-on-one with leading American professors in cutting-edge studies of their interest, culminating in original research and authoritative evaluations from their professors.

Position Description:
Pioneer Academics seeks a staff member with experience developing and refining business processes, systems, and policies for effectiveness and efficiency in meeting programmatic and organizational goals.
Key Responsibilities:
- Creating and distributing student and faculty accounts for instructional technology platforms and tools, to include the learning management system (LMS), Web-conferencing platform, and collaboration and presentation tools.
- Maintain organization of students and faculty assigned to appropriate courses, groups, etc. across multiple technology systems including terminations at the conclusion of each program
- Owning the communication process to all students and faculty using various methods to create and communicate important updates, announcements, individual correspondence, and post-program notifications
- Develop and maintain a master program schedule, including live session days and times and relevant staff coverage. Schedule these sessions and associated reminders, as needed, in the relevant technology platforms (i.e., LMS, Web-conferencing platform).
- Monitor program communication channels (e.g., program’s sharing email account, messages through LMS) and respond to or escalate issues according to established policies and protocols. Track and analyze issues and recommend policy and process changes to reduce the prevalence of recurring issues.
- Develop and maintain a range of forms and documentation to monitor student attendance and engagement according to established program policies and objectives.
- Build program content in the learning management system (LMS) according to program guidelines.
- Manage the program’s content catalog (i.e., faculty video lectures, curated readings, third-party videos, etc.).
- Administer program surveys (pre-, mid-, and post-program) to students, faculty, and other stakeholders. Compile and analyze survey data and make recommendations for improvements based on these data.
- Oversee the work of contracted staff serving in program coordination roles.
